 ColorThe color module provides a basic set of classes for dealing with color systems and color schemes
 CommonThe common module contains the foundation classes and functions for all TerraLib modules
 Data AccessThe data access module provides a basic framework for accessing data
 Data TypeThe data type module implements the type system supported by TerraLib for dealing with data that comes from different data sources
 Filter EncodingThis module implements the OGC Filter Encoding specification
 GeometryThis module implements the vector geometry support of TerraLib
 Map ToolsThe map tools module provides some basic abstractions for handling spatial data in the form of a map
 MemoryThis module can be used to manage geographical data with a representation stored in RAM memory
 DTM ProcessingThis module provides classes and functions with DTM processing capabilities
 PluginThe plugin module provides support for the startup and shutdown of modules loaded at run time
 QtThis module provides some geospatial components and a framework based on Qt
 Application FrameworkThis module provides a framework to help customizing an application built on top of TerraLib's Qt Components
 WidgetsThis module provides the GUI components for dealing with geospatial concepts
 RasterThis module can be used to manage geographical data with raster representation
 Raster ProcessingThis module provides classes and functions with raster processing capabilities
